The Irish Mail Rock & Pop Opened in 1841An outstanding, original, railway poster, The Irish Mail, painted by FH Glazebrook and published by the London Midland and Scottish Railway (LMS) in about 1932. The striking artwork depicts the Irish Mail (a famous named train) emerging from Stephensons Britannia Bridge connecting Anglesey with the north Wales mainland.
